Understanding the local watch market

The Vancouver watch market is active throughout the year with steady demand from collectors and casual buyers. Rolex and Omega models often sell faster than others because they hold strong resale value in Canada. Some limited editions can reach prices above CAD 15,000 when condition and paperwork are perfect.

Many sellers underestimate how much condition affects final price, especially when small scratches or missing papers reduce buyer confidence in competitive listings. A watch that is well maintained with service records often attracts offers that are 10 to 25 percent higher than similar models without documentation. Simple research before selling can prevent low offers and help you understand real market expectations. Timing matters. Prices change fast.

Preparing your watch for a better price

Preparation plays a big role in getting a strong offer when selling a watch in Vancouver because buyers pay close attention to presentation and authenticity details. Cleaning the watch gently and including original box and papers can increase value by several hundred dollars in some cases. Taking clear photos and showing all angles helps buyers trust your listing more easily.

A simple checklist can help sellers stay organized before meeting buyers or posting their watch online. Clean the watch carefully, gather documents, and check recent market prices before setting expectations. Avoid rushing into the first offer since better deals often appear after comparing at least two or three buyers in the city.
